The Wiccan spring equinox, also known as Ostara, is a significant celebration in the Wiccan calendar. It occurs around March 20th or 21st in the northern hemisphere and marks the arrival of spring. During this time, Wiccans celebrate the balance between light and darkness as the days become longer and the nights shorter. It is seen as a time of renewal, growth, and fertility in nature. The earth starts to awaken from its winter slumber, and new life begins to emerge. Ostara is often associated with themes of eggs, rabbits, and flowers.

Ostara is often associated with themes of eggs, rabbits, and flowers. These symbols symbolize fertility and the cycle of life. Many Wiccans participate in egg decorating rituals and incorporate these symbols into their ceremonies.

The spring equinox is a time for Wiccans to connect with the energy of nature and attune themselves to the changing seasons. They may hold rituals outdoors, honoring the earth and the elements. It is also a time for new beginnings and setting intentions for the coming year. During Ostara, Wiccans may also perform spells or rituals geared towards personal growth, abundance, and manifestation. This is a time to plant metaphorical seeds for goals and aspirations, harnessing the energy of spring to support their manifestation. Overall, the Wiccan spring equinox is a joyous celebration of the turning of the seasons and the awakening of nature. It is a time to honor the balance of light and dark, and to embrace the energy of growth and renewal..
